What $100,000 Means for Humphreys County Families

A $100,000 life insurance policy is often sought by Tennessee residents looking for fundamental protection without a large premium commitment. This coverage level can help cover final expenses such as funeral and burial costs, pay off smaller debts like a car loan or credit card balances, and provide a short-term financial bridge for a surviving spouse or family. It is a common starting point for younger individuals building their financial foundation or for older adults supplementing existing coverage.

For Humphreys County residents specifically, $100,000 in coverage represents 2.3x the median household income and 69% of the median home value. Humphreys County's experience with the 2021 Waverly floods heightened awareness of financial preparedness, including life insurance. Many families recognized the importance of having coverage in place before disaster strikes. The county's manufacturing base — including Loretta Lynn's Ranch area tourism — provides some employer coverage, but many residents need individual policies. Modest incomes make term insurance the most practical choice.

Illustrative Rates

$100,000 Life Insurance Rates

Illustrative monthly premiums for $100,000 coverage. Rates shown for preferred non-smoker health classification.

Age Group Term Life (Monthly) Whole Life (Monthly) Health Class
Age 30 $8 – $12 $55 – $80 Preferred Non-Smoker
Age 40 $12 – $18 $75 – $110 Preferred Non-Smoker
Age 50 $25 – $40 $120 – $175 Preferred Non-Smoker
Age 60 $60 – $100 $200 – $310 Preferred Non-Smoker

All rates are illustrative for a healthy non-smoker and do not represent a specific carrier's pricing. Actual premiums vary by carrier and individual underwriting, including age, health status, tobacco use, and coverage amount. Employer-provided life insurance from companies like Humphreys County Schools and Three Rivers Hospital typically provides only 1-2 times your annual salary and ends when you leave the job. A personal $100,000 policy provides portable protection that stays with you regardless of employment changes. A licensed agent in our network can help evaluate your total coverage needs.
